  4. I flush every third feed (feed, feed, flush/feed. After solid 2 part flush, with a shit load of drain off, I feed them so they’ll stay well feed. You obviously don’t flush living soil. Need to flush to get rid of salt build ups that can lock out the nutrients. It’s WAY more important if you’re feeding bottled nutes because most companies feed charts are super strong.
